This guide to the Balboa Theatre on Fourth Avenue follows a Wonder Morton organ pried loose from a shuttered Queens movie palace and trucked nearly three thousand miles west with no guarantee it would ever play again. It traces the theater's own near-collapse, closed in nineteen eighty-five when engineers found its nineteen twenty-four concrete frame too fragile to survive an earthquake, and the delicate structural fix needed to save it without moving its locked-in footprint.
